our application was received on the 10th of nov
i got a letter monday, dated the 15th of march refusing fis.
we were refused as the lady said we would be better off if myself and the kids were on my partner's BTEA claim.
i still dont get it.
if you add my wages and his btea per week together its no where near €606....
we have no other income.
i called them yesterday but the babies were crying and i had to hang up so ill try again today.
EDIT: got through to them again today, they were very helpful.
The income they have for me is based on the previous 43 weeks, including when i had a full time job!!
this amount is €100 more than i have been earning since last july.
This average puts us €15 over €606 per week....
So I have to re-apply again, now as we are entitled, its 43 weeks since i had a full time job.

does my employer fill out the form when im on maternity leave? Im not back till june.
|
Your employer needs to fill out the application with the info from the last 4 weeks before you went on maternity,then there is an average worked out between Mat leave and wages.
I would ring the person who refused you before you summit the new application and ask can you send it direct to them,it usually means it will not take as long to process it.
